The peach-shaped water tower is pictured, Jan. 3, 2011, in Clanton, Alabama. Clanton, located in Chilton County, is known for its peaches. The water tower was built by Chicago Bridge & Iron Company in 1992. It is 120 feet tall and holds 500, 000 gallons of water. It is located off exit 212 on I-65. (Photo by Carmen K. Sisson/Cloudybright)
